Block Carbs, Burn Body Fat: Can It Effectively Perform?

The "block carbs, burn fat" approach to fat reduction has exploded in trendiness, promising a seemingly easy solution for those struggling with unwanted fat. But does it actually offer on its claims? The underlying idea is relatively straightforward: by reducing your intake of carbohydrates, your body is forced to change to burning stored fat for fuel. While there's a grain of validity to this, the picture is far complex. Completely avoiding carbs is rarely sustainable in the long run, and can lead to shortages in vitamins and minerals. Moreover, a extreme carb restriction can negatively impact your metabolism and overall well-being. A holistic approach, focusing on nutrient-dense, real foods and a controlled amount of carbs, alongside a fitness regime, is generally a more effective strategy for sustainable fat reduction.

Examining Starch & Grease Blockers: An Research-Based Analysis at Efficacy

The appeal of starch and fat blockers has generated considerable interest, but a close investigation of their documented effectiveness demands a more detailed research-based understanding. While some supplements claim to interfere the body’s ability to process sugars and greases, the existing data is mostly inconclusive. Many investigations have indicated minimal to no significant influence on fat reduction or general physiological fitness. Additionally, the processes by which these compounds are supposed to work often require additional investigation, and potential unwanted effects persist a consideration for certain users. Ultimately, depending solely on carb and fat blockers for weight management is unlikely to yield long-term outcomes without accompanying dietary adjustments.

A Utilizes More Quickly: Fat Burning vs. Glucose Metabolism

The age-old question of whether lipid burning or sugar burning is expeditiously isn't as straightforward as many assume. Initially, sugars are broken down more quickly and provide a more immediate energy source, leading to a quicker burn rate to begin with. This is because sugars require less effort to convert into usable power for your structure. However, when it comes to sustained energy production, body burning actually dominates. While the starting energy burst is from carbs, the energy derived from body stores is much greater and can be sustained for a significantly increased period, especially during lower-intensity activities or once glucose stores are used up. Therefore, it’s not about which burns faster specifically, but which supplies a more beneficial and enduring energy source.
